社区
PostgreSQL
帖子详情
关于Pg数组类型字段的查询和写入性能问题
kafan5502
2017-11-20 02:33:55
比如说,我现在一条记录中有5个同义字段,可以用数组来整合成一个字段,那么这两种方式,对于海量数据(单表上1亿)来说,插入性能理论上谁更好点? 查询性能谁更好点? 如果数组字段为data,我这边查询的计划显示,虽然走了索引(表中存在索引列),但是select data和select data[1]的性能差距非常大,实际耗时差了几千倍。。。
...全文
869
3
打赏
收藏
关于Pg数组类型字段的查询和写入性能问题
比如说,我现在一条记录中有5个同义字段,可以用数组来整合成一个字段,那么这两种方式,对于海量数据(单表上1亿)来说,插入性能理论上谁更好点? 查询性能谁更好点? 如果数组字段为data,我这边查询的计划显示,虽然走了索引(表中存在索引列),但是select data和select data[1]的性能差距非常大,实际耗时差了几千倍。。。
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
3 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
trainee
2017-11-22
打赏
举报
回复
如果这5个字段其中需要用到索引,就没必要整合成一个数组.
kafan5502
2017-11-21
打赏
举报
回复
UPUPUPUPUPUPUPUPUPUPUPUPUPUPUPUPUPUPUPUP
php网络开发完全手册
4.3 关于引用的解释 67 4.3.1 对变量的引用 67 4.3.2 对函数的引用 68 4.3.3 引用的释放 68 4.4 小结 69 第5章 PHP中类的应用 70 5.1 PHP中OOP的应用 70 5.1.1 类简介 70 5.1.2 类的信息封装 71 5.1.3 静态类 71 5.2...
Postgre SQL数据库存储
数组
类型
字段
character varing[] Mybatis
postgre数据库存储
数组
类型
字段
character varing[] mybatis
踩坑记录:
pg
sql插入
数组
类型
的数据和命名
然而character varying[]是
数组
类型
,正确的插入方式应该参考
数组
的插入,正确插入的例子如下 insert into ac (ab) values(ARRAY [ 'x', 'y' ])```//将
数组
{x,y}插入到表ac的ab列中 - 另外关于命名,如果大小写...
您的配置文件中的列配置信息有误. 因为DataX 不支持数据库
写入
这种
字段
类型
.
字段
名:[xx],
字段
类型
:[1111],
字段
Java
类型
:[jsonb].
Description:[不支持的数据库
类型
. 请注意查看 DataX 已经支持的...从报错信息中可知是source端出了
问题
,赶紧检查了一下表结构
字段
类型
,发现hive端该
字段
类型
为STRING,
pg
端
字段
类型
为jsonb,正常不应该出现
问题
的啊。
随记1 ------ psql如何在表中插入
数组
值
创建一个联系人表,
字段
有id, 联系人姓名,联系方式。由于一个人可能有两个或者多个手机号,所以phone
字段
用
数组
表示。
PostgreSQL
954
社区成员
1,459
社区内容
发帖
与我相关
我的任务
PostgreSQL
PostgreSQL相关内容讨论
复制链接
扫一扫
分享
社区描述
PostgreSQL相关内容讨论
sql
数据库
数据库架构
技术论坛(原bbs)
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章